We headed downstairs for breakfast at ME by Mallorca hotel. It was a long drive to get to this hotel from the airport but it was worth it. The hotel was large, yet intimate with another sister hotel on the property.  Guess what? Nikki Beach was on the other side of ME by Mallorca. This gave us so many options for food, fun and day parties.
 ​
Picture

Breakfast was a full spread of fruits, pastries and hot food. It was the perfect start to the day. After breakfast we reserved our Cabana and headed back to the our room to put on our beach gear.  The room was a great size with a spacious glass shower, king bed and private wet room. There was  a sitting area with a large balcony. Sigh. I want to go back.
 
Our Cabana was so necessary with the bright sun. We sat and really relaxed the day away by reading, taking a dip in the sea and having lunch in the hotel restaurant. Burgers for everyone! I only have burgers when I go on trips. It’s a rule that helps me keep the pounds down.
